We have loved David Beard's catfish for decades. We don't have one near us but when we travel we most often visit it. It's been over a year since we've been able to go to one. We went today through Azle TX and visited the David Beard's there. We learned that they have changed the type of catfish they used, the breading of the catfish, and the hush puppies that we once loved and bragged on. The food was horrible. We were told that all restaurants changed the fish and hushpuppies over a year ago. Needless to say, we will never go back again.
